사람부터

"사람부터" means "starting from people" or "from people first."


In this sentence, '사람부터' emphasizes starting with addressing or persuading people as a crucial initial step to resolve the problem.

이 문제를 해결하려면 사람부터 설득해야 효과적이에요.

To address this issue, it is effective to first convince the people.


Here, '사람부터' signifies prioritizing people in the process, emphasizing their importance over other tasks before the event starts.

행사를 시작하기 전에 사람부터 자리 잡아야 해요.

Before starting the event, we should first get people settled in their seats.


Here, '사람부터' indicates the initial focus on preparations involving people as a foundational aspect of the task.

이 일을 잘 하려면 준비를 사람부터 철저히 해야 합니다.

To do this work well, one must prepare thoroughly, starting with the people.
